“Tough” and “tease” don’t usually go together in the same sentence, but for the 2017 Acura MDX the universe is making an exception.

The company plans to unveil a redesign of the SUV on March 23 at the New York International Auto Show. Why? Because people get bored. Also, the revised MDX will feature “substantial design enhancements, added luxury comfort and convenience features, and advanced new powertrain technology.”

Like Apple’s products, the new MDX was designed in California (by Acura’s design studio in Torrance) and like “To Kill a Mockingbird” it will be produced in Alabama. While we don’t know precisely what it will look like, our fingers are crossed that it will look like Acura’s supercar, the NSX.

Have you never driven an MDX? That’s a shame. It just got a dual-clutch, 9-speed automatic transmission last year along with super handling all-wheel drive. That means it’s very efficient with fuel and better at handling in slippery road conditions.
